Stylish-Looking Basketball Game With Hand-Drawn Art Revealed, Looks Incredible


Independent game developer Play by Play Studios has announced its formation and revealed its first project, which is a character-driven 3v3 basketball game that celebrates the sport and its culture.

The Run: Got Next is the name of the game, and it aims to be easy to pick up and play, but also deep enough for people looking for a challenge. The full-court 3v3 game bends the rules of real basketball “in the name of fun,” but is not a full-on arcade-style basketball game. Take a look for yourself in the trailer below.

Players assemble a roster of players, each with their unique move-sets, with the aim of building a winning streak and holding court. The game has different courts to play on, and each favors a different type of playstyle. There is also an in-game shop featuring items, abilities, sponsors, and shoes that players can acquire, though whether or not this is a real-money shop is unknown.

The Run: Got Next aims for a “hand-crafted” art style with a stylized look. The game has hand-painted textures, cel-shaded characters, and hand-keyed animations.

Some of the people at Play by Play Studios worked on titles like NBA Street, Battlefield, Madden, God of War, Apex Legends, Dead Space, and League of Legends.

The Run: Got Next has been in development for more than two years already and is aiming to launch in 2025 on Steam, PS5, and Xbox Series X|S.
